Output 4c58404c3f533a2bef465984e59a58e143bbc263987fbcd91355c59ba8ad8fbc:40

value
109900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b6b3008699324718a264b2b65a5f14842cf81d OP_EQUAL
address
MFAeUkRwkrTjKXQajXH7m5o122gyKUikbn
transaction
4c58404c3f533a2bef465984e59a58e143bbc263987fbcd91355c59ba8ad8fbc
spent
true